学习网站制作建站CMS,我能掌握哪些实用技能?
- 内容介绍
- 相关推荐
网站已成为企业与用户连接的核心桥梁。某平台部署的WAF防火墙, 通过机器学习模型实时分析请求特征,成功拦截日均2000余次CC攻击。 一句话。 从静态展示到动态交互, 从单一功能到生态整合,网站建设早已突破传统框架,向更高效、智能的方向演进。
今天我再来介绍一下 在我们正式开始制作一个网站时我们需要掌握的一些知识技能. 既然我们是学习怎么用CMS来构建自己的网站,所以在这个系列教程中,我们需要重点学会一种CMS建站程序。
如果你曾经尝试过把一张海报直接粘贴进Word文档做成“网页”,那就知道单纯的内容堆砌根本无法带来真正的用户体验。 我CPU干烧了。 现在有了CMS,你可以像画布一样自由拼接文字、图片和互动元素,却不必担心底层代码。
1️⃣ 什么是 CMS?——内容管理系统到底干什么?
CMS是一套让非技术人员也能轻松创建和维护网站的软件框架。
- No-code 控制面板:User-friendly Dashboard, 让你通过拖拽或表单即可发布文章、图片或产品。
- Dynamically Rendered Pages:数据存储在数据库里每一次请求都被服务器即时渲染成完整页面。
- Ecosystem of Plugins:The plugin marketplace 给你无限 功能, 从SEO优化到社交分享,一键搞定。
- User Management & Security:A robust auntication system 把你的内容平安放在第一位。
- A/B Testing & Analytics Integration:You can plug in Google Analytics or Hotjar effortlessly.
第一次打开 WordPress 后台时我那股“可以直接把世界装进桌面”的冲动真是难以言喻。 是个狼人。 它把复杂度降到最低,却又不失强大的可 性——这正是我想要寻找的平衡点。
📌 CMS 的核心价值:时间 vs 技术成本 ⚖️
绝了... CMS 的最大卖点就是节省时间。相比从零开始编码,你可以在几天内完成一个全功能的网站,而不是数月甚至数年的研发周期。这意味着你可以更快地测试市场假设,更快地收集用户反馈,并且更快迭代产品。
🖥️ 2️⃣ 学习前端:HTML + CSS + JavaScript 的三重奏
“没事就写一点 CSS,让页面看起来像水墨画。”——这句话一直激励着我不断完善视觉细节。下面我们拆解这三项技能的重点内容:,可以。
💡 ① HTML 基础 & 语义化标签
- , : 页面头部与尾部统一结构;
- : 导航条, 用于定义主导航菜单;
- , : 内容分块,可提高搜索引擎抓取效率;
- : 必须提供 alt 文本,为视觉障碍者友好,一边也提升 SEO;
- - 在页面内部快速定位时使用
- 常见错误提醒:- 忘记闭合标签容易导致子元素渲染错位,如 `` 未闭合会使整个布局偏移。
🌈 ② CSS 排版 & 响应式布局
曾经有一次 在为客户做移动版页面时我把所有列宽写成固定 px,却忽视了手机屏幕尺寸,小朋友 这就说得通了。 们居然把按钮挤成了一坨小虫子……从此我下决心要彻底学会 Flexbox 和 Grid 布局!
- •Flexbox 简化线性布局:Makes aligning items along a single axis trivial.
- •Grid 二维布局魔法:Create complex grid structures without nested tables.
- •媒体查询 Media Queries:@media screen and { … } 用于不同设备自适应显示。
- •CSS Variables :::root { --primary-color:#3498db;} 可维护统一主题色彩。
- # 小技巧 # - 使用 rem 单位替代 px,提高跨设备一致性。
- # 常见错误 # - 忘记添加 -webkit- 前缀导致 Safari 渲染异常;或者未使用 flex-wrap 导致弹性盒子溢出父容器。
- # 推荐工具 # - Chrome DevTools Layout Panel 可以即时预览 Flex/Grid 布局效果;Figma 或 Sketch 能帮你先做视觉稿, 再手工写 CSS,避免跑步式改动。
- WordPress 等主流 CMS 正基于 PHP 构建
- 社区庞大数百万行开源插件
- 部署简易共享主机普遍支持 PHP
开头可能因short_open_tag设置关闭mysqli与PDO两种数据库抽象层, 各有优劣- 前期侧重前端基础与 CMS 熟悉度
- 中期加深后端语言和数据库知识
- 长期保持关注平安与性能最佳实践
🔧 小实验
尝试打开 Chrome DevTools → Sources → Snippets,把以下脚本复制进去运行: js console.log; // 浏览器控制台输出 如果能看到 `Hello world!` 那说明你已经准备好迎接 JavaScript 世界啦。🚀
| 技术 | 学习目标 | 推荐资源 |
|---|---|---|
| HTML | 理解语义化结构 | MDN Web Docs |
| CSS | 灵活排版 + 响应式 | freeCodeCamp |
| JavaScript | 增强交互 + DOM 操作 | Eloquent JS |
📚 三、大步向后端迈进:PHP / Node.js / Python
🎯 为什么选择 PHP?
📦 快速入门
php
常见坑:
🔒 四、平安加固:WAF、防火墙及 HTTPS
🌐 WAF 原理简述
通过分析 HTTP 请求特征,自动识别并阻断恶意攻击,比方说 CC/SQLi/CSRF 等。
✅ HTTPS 必备
bash
我比较认同... certbot --apache -d example.com -d www.example.com
🗺️ 五、 SEO 与性能优化
| 步骤 | 工具/方法 |
|---|---|
| 标题 / 描述标签 | Yoast SEO 或 Rank Math |
| Sitemap.xml / robots.txt | 自动生成插件 |
| 页面缓存 | WP Super Cache 或 Nginx FastCGI 缓存 |
| 图片压缩 | ShortPixel 或 TinyPNG |
🎉 六、实战项目建议
1️⃣ 个人博客 – WordPress + Divi Theme - 至于吗? 每周更新一次文章 - 配置 Google Search Console
2️⃣ 电商小店 – WooCommerce - 集成 Stripe 支付 - 启用 AB 测试插件,希望大家...
你我共勉。 3️⃣ 企业官网 – Drupal - 多语言支持 - 内部权限管理
🤝 七、社区与持续学习
加入相关论坛、订阅 YouTube 技术频道,每周至少阅读一篇技术博客,让自己的知识库持续更新。
💡 小结:从零到一, 再从一到十
这事儿我可太有发言权了。 每一步都不是孤立,而是一条连贯的数据链路——当你终于将所有模块拼装完毕,那种手中掌控整个互联网世界的满足感,是任何编程语言都无法替代的。愿你的每一次点击,都能为读者带去价值,也愿你的每一次部署,都伴随微风般顺畅。祝你建站愉快 🚀!
交学费了。 © 2026 建站达人 版权所有 · 本文采用 CC BY-SA 协议授权转载
网站已成为企业与用户连接的核心桥梁。某平台部署的WAF防火墙, 通过机器学习模型实时分析请求特征,成功拦截日均2000余次CC攻击。 一句话。 从静态展示到动态交互, 从单一功能到生态整合,网站建设早已突破传统框架,向更高效、智能的方向演进。
今天我再来介绍一下 在我们正式开始制作一个网站时我们需要掌握的一些知识技能. 既然我们是学习怎么用CMS来构建自己的网站,所以在这个系列教程中,我们需要重点学会一种CMS建站程序。
如果你曾经尝试过把一张海报直接粘贴进Word文档做成“网页”,那就知道单纯的内容堆砌根本无法带来真正的用户体验。 我CPU干烧了。 现在有了CMS,你可以像画布一样自由拼接文字、图片和互动元素,却不必担心底层代码。
1️⃣ 什么是 CMS?——内容管理系统到底干什么?
CMS是一套让非技术人员也能轻松创建和维护网站的软件框架。
- No-code 控制面板:User-friendly Dashboard, 让你通过拖拽或表单即可发布文章、图片或产品。
- Dynamically Rendered Pages:数据存储在数据库里每一次请求都被服务器即时渲染成完整页面。
- Ecosystem of Plugins:The plugin marketplace 给你无限 功能, 从SEO优化到社交分享,一键搞定。
- User Management & Security:A robust auntication system 把你的内容平安放在第一位。
- A/B Testing & Analytics Integration:You can plug in Google Analytics or Hotjar effortlessly.
第一次打开 WordPress 后台时我那股“可以直接把世界装进桌面”的冲动真是难以言喻。 是个狼人。 它把复杂度降到最低,却又不失强大的可 性——这正是我想要寻找的平衡点。
📌 CMS 的核心价值:时间 vs 技术成本 ⚖️
绝了... CMS 的最大卖点就是节省时间。相比从零开始编码,你可以在几天内完成一个全功能的网站,而不是数月甚至数年的研发周期。这意味着你可以更快地测试市场假设,更快地收集用户反馈,并且更快迭代产品。
🖥️ 2️⃣ 学习前端:HTML + CSS + JavaScript 的三重奏
“没事就写一点 CSS,让页面看起来像水墨画。”——这句话一直激励着我不断完善视觉细节。下面我们拆解这三项技能的重点内容:,可以。
💡 ① HTML 基础 & 语义化标签
- , : 页面头部与尾部统一结构;
- : 导航条, 用于定义主导航菜单;
- , : 内容分块,可提高搜索引擎抓取效率;
- : 必须提供 alt 文本,为视觉障碍者友好,一边也提升 SEO;
- - 在页面内部快速定位时使用
- 常见错误提醒:- 忘记闭合标签容易导致子元素渲染错位,如 `` 未闭合会使整个布局偏移。
🌈 ② CSS 排版 & 响应式布局
曾经有一次 在为客户做移动版页面时我把所有列宽写成固定 px,却忽视了手机屏幕尺寸,小朋友 这就说得通了。 们居然把按钮挤成了一坨小虫子……从此我下决心要彻底学会 Flexbox 和 Grid 布局!
- •Flexbox 简化线性布局:Makes aligning items along a single axis trivial.
- •Grid 二维布局魔法:Create complex grid structures without nested tables.
- •媒体查询 Media Queries:@media screen and { … } 用于不同设备自适应显示。
- •CSS Variables :::root { --primary-color:#3498db;} 可维护统一主题色彩。
- # 小技巧 # - 使用 rem 单位替代 px,提高跨设备一致性。
- # 常见错误 # - 忘记添加 -webkit- 前缀导致 Safari 渲染异常;或者未使用 flex-wrap 导致弹性盒子溢出父容器。
- # 推荐工具 # - Chrome DevTools Layout Panel 可以即时预览 Flex/Grid 布局效果;Figma 或 Sketch 能帮你先做视觉稿, 再手工写 CSS,避免跑步式改动。
- WordPress 等主流 CMS 正基于 PHP 构建
- 社区庞大数百万行开源插件
- 部署简易共享主机普遍支持 PHP
开头可能因short_open_tag设置关闭mysqli与PDO两种数据库抽象层, 各有优劣- 前期侧重前端基础与 CMS 熟悉度
- 中期加深后端语言和数据库知识
- 长期保持关注平安与性能最佳实践
🔧 小实验
尝试打开 Chrome DevTools → Sources → Snippets,把以下脚本复制进去运行: js console.log; // 浏览器控制台输出 如果能看到 `Hello world!` 那说明你已经准备好迎接 JavaScript 世界啦。🚀
| 技术 | 学习目标 | 推荐资源 |
|---|---|---|
| HTML | 理解语义化结构 | MDN Web Docs |
| CSS | 灵活排版 + 响应式 | freeCodeCamp |
| JavaScript | 增强交互 + DOM 操作 | Eloquent JS |
📚 三、大步向后端迈进:PHP / Node.js / Python
🎯 为什么选择 PHP?
📦 快速入门
php
常见坑:
🔒 四、平安加固:WAF、防火墙及 HTTPS
🌐 WAF 原理简述
通过分析 HTTP 请求特征,自动识别并阻断恶意攻击,比方说 CC/SQLi/CSRF 等。
✅ HTTPS 必备
bash
我比较认同... certbot --apache -d example.com -d www.example.com
🗺️ 五、 SEO 与性能优化
| 步骤 | 工具/方法 |
|---|---|
| 标题 / 描述标签 | Yoast SEO 或 Rank Math |
| Sitemap.xml / robots.txt | 自动生成插件 |
| 页面缓存 | WP Super Cache 或 Nginx FastCGI 缓存 |
| 图片压缩 | ShortPixel 或 TinyPNG |
🎉 六、实战项目建议
1️⃣ 个人博客 – WordPress + Divi Theme - 至于吗? 每周更新一次文章 - 配置 Google Search Console
2️⃣ 电商小店 – WooCommerce - 集成 Stripe 支付 - 启用 AB 测试插件,希望大家...
你我共勉。 3️⃣ 企业官网 – Drupal - 多语言支持 - 内部权限管理
🤝 七、社区与持续学习
加入相关论坛、订阅 YouTube 技术频道,每周至少阅读一篇技术博客,让自己的知识库持续更新。
💡 小结:从零到一, 再从一到十
这事儿我可太有发言权了。 每一步都不是孤立,而是一条连贯的数据链路——当你终于将所有模块拼装完毕,那种手中掌控整个互联网世界的满足感,是任何编程语言都无法替代的。愿你的每一次点击,都能为读者带去价值,也愿你的每一次部署,都伴随微风般顺畅。祝你建站愉快 🚀!
交学费了。 © 2026 建站达人 版权所有 · 本文采用 CC BY-SA 协议授权转载

